A larger drive wheel on a 2×72 belt grinder significantly enhances performance by increasing belt speed, improving belt life, and reducing vibration. A 7-inch drive wheel strikes an ideal balance, offering optimal grinding efficiency, smoother operation, and extended durability. Drive wheel size plays a crucial role in maximizing grinder performance.

This article compares ceramic and aluminum oxide grinding belts, emphasizing that while ceramic belts are pricier, they offer superior performance for heavy-duty tasks like steel removal. Aluminum oxide belts remain useful for lighter jobs due to their affordability. The author recommends a balanced approach, using both types strategically to optimize cost and performance.
